My extruder is a printed plastic unit, which feeds the filament through a PTFE spacer to the hot end. PTFE isn't the greatest material out as it does tend to deform slightly when hot and under pressure and I've had to drill out my spacer once or twice to stop jamming - it may be PTFE but if the 'ole up the middle ain't big enough, the filament won't get through no how! Out of interest, have you checked how consistent the diameter of your filament is? I understand that not all PLA is the same - some can vary somewhat in diameter.
